WebThis can happen during unprotected sex or while sharing needles used to inject (“shoot”) drugs. A baby can be infected during birth if the mother has hepatitis B. Hepatitis B virus also can be spread if you live with an infected person and share household items that may come into contact with body fluids, such as toothbrushes or razors. WebTherefore, the Hepatitis B Foundation strongly recommends that health care professionals properly administer the birth dose of the hepatitis B vaccine immediately in the delivery room to avoid any delays or mistakes. The U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) … WebPreventing perinatal HBV transmission is an integral part of the national strategy to eliminate hepatitis B in the United States. National guidelines call for the following: Universal screening of pregnant persons for HBsAg during each pregnancy. HBV DNA testing for HBsAg-positive pregnant persons at 26-28 weeks to guide the use of maternal ...
